== English == === Noun === tractive effort (plural tractive efforts) (engineering, rail transport) the tractive force that can be generated by a prime mover to pull a load; cardinal examples are a locomotive pulling a train, a semi-tractor pulling a trailer or a tractor pulling a plow. ==== Synonyms ==== tractive force ==== Coordinate terms ==== thrust (the analogue for aircraft engines, rocket engines, and watercraft propulsion) torque (moment of force) (the analogue in rotational reference)
